The documents are scattered across the formal collection of &#8220;Director&#8217;s Office Files&#8221; found in the organized and boxed Berea College microfilmed records; in the Pine Mountain Settlement School&#8217;s general Director&#8217;s files; in the Rural Youth Guidance Institute files (partial); and within the correspondence of other Pine Mountain Settlement School staff, students and associates.&nbsp;The documents associated with Glyn Morris&#8217;s are voluminous and often necessarily duplicates across various collections.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">When Morris reflected on his time at Pine Mountain in 1977, he was 72. He was retired and living in Pennsylvania where he was writing his autobiography. He mused<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><em>I sometimes ponder, with wonder, as to how the concept of time has changed in my lifetime. From knowing men who fought in the Civil War &#8212; my experience covered nearly a century &#8212; and who could tell of their experiences, to the space age! How fast can we go and survive?<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Morris did not live to know the web and its rapid technology and media development and dissemination. He would have heard us asking the same question: <em>How fast can we go and survive?<\/em> <\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ator is-style-wide\"\/>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"has-text-align-center w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>See Also: <a href=\"http:\/\/staging.pinemountainsettlement.net\/?page_id=1015\">GLYN MORRIS<\/a> Biography<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ator is-style-wide\"\/>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">GLYN MORRIS Guide Writing and Publications:<br \/><strong>SPEECHES, WRITING\u00a0(UNPUBLISHED)<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>1931<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Glyn Morris&#8217;s first year as Director of Pine Mountain Settlement School can be found in these documents that capture exchanges with his staff, outside resources and previous contacts. Arriving at the school at the age of 27, Morris, with all the eagerness of youth, clearly had grand ideas as he charts a new course for the School. Influenced by his instruction at Union Theological School in New York and instructors such as <a href=\"https:\/\/en.wikipedia.org\/wiki\/Reinhold_Niebuhr\">Reinhold Niebuhr<\/a>, and a strong interest in the new educational ideas of<a href=\"https:\/\/en.wikipedia.org\/wiki\/John_Dewey\"> John Dewey<\/a> and others, Morris set about to develop a new educational philosophy for the Settlement School.&nbsp;In his own words Morris describes that initial transition from the intensely urban environment of New York City to the isolated rural community of Pine Mountain in the Central Appalachians of Kentucky in his 1977 autobiography, <em>Less Travelled Roads<\/em>: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<blockquote class=\"w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ow\"><p><em>The move from New York to Pine Mountain, Kentucky, took us from one extreme to another; the move meant not only a change in geography, but with respect to surroundings, customs, and methods of living, placed us back into an earlier period of history. We exchanged subways and towering modern buildings and apartment houses for log cabins, muleback and foot travel; the sophisticated environment of Morningside Heights and the pushing crowds of Times Square for the restrained, &#8220;furriner-shy&#8221; non-talkative mountaineers; Macy&#8217;s department store, Fifth Avenue shops for a small, sparsely stocked country store and the &#8220;Wish Book&#8221; (any mail-order house catalogue &#8212; mainly Sears and &#8220;Monkey Wards&#8221;). Childs&#8217; and Chinese restaurants for cornbread, shucky\u00a0beans and heavy doses of salt pork and breakfasts with thick gravy. The rush and bustle of the city for the slow pace of the time before the railroads, the place where, as <a href=\"http:\/\/staging.pinemountainsettlement.net\/?page_id=91778\">James Stil<\/a>l stated, &#8220;&#8230;men here wait as mountains long have waited.&#8221; <\/em><\/p><cite>Morris, Glyn.<em>&nbsp;Less Travelled Roads.<\/em>&nbsp;New York: Vantage Press, 1977. Print.<\/cite><\/blockquote>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>1932<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">1932<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">1933<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">1934<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">1935<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">1936<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>1937<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">By 1937 Morris had begun to doubt himself and his reasons for remaining at Pine Mountain. He wrote to his mentor <strong>Arthur J. Swift<\/strong> at Union Theological,&nbsp;<em>&#8220;Gladys and I are thinking of leaving Pine Mountain\u2026.Now will you tell us in all frankness just what you&nbsp;think?&#8221;<\/em> He stayed.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ong><a href=\"http:\/\/staging.pinemountainsettlement.net\/?page_id=73390\">GLYN MORRIS TALKS 1937 &#8216;Tight Places<\/a><\/strong>&#8216;, including a prayer.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>1938<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><a href=\"http:\/\/staging.pinemountainsettlement.net\/?page_id=65632\">Harlan County Planning Council Minutes<\/a>.
